Ordinals
beta
Address 1NWCSMED32DgGFucmTUZB6gjd89CKyfdgy
sat balance
362101
outputs
76a3b3e703eb082e1bbaf8fe9d8b834a53f6837ba7e512330046657328ff35d7:1